@Override
public boolean sendMoveEvent(String moveEventJson) {
// AutoBean decode
Beanery beanFactory = AutoBeanFactorySource.create(Beanery.class);
MoveEvent e = AutoBeanCodex.decode(beanFactory, MoveEvent.class, moveEventJson).as();
int toIndex = e.getTo();
int fromIndex = e.getFrom();
log.info("FileCollection contains");
for (String s : FileCollection.get().getBlobKeys()) {
log.info(" " + s);
}
FileCollection.get().move(toIndex, fromIndex).save();